What is a Bitcoin Casino?
A Bitcoin casino is an online gambling platform that accepts Bitcoin (BTC) as a main technique for deposits, wagers, and withdrawals. While some platforms operate exclusively on cryptocurrency, lots of "hybrid" gambling establishments accept both fiat currency (like GBP or EUR) and different digital properties.
Unlike conventional online casinos that count on banks and credit card processors, Bitcoin gambling establishments leverage blockchain technology. This fundamentally alters how transactions are processed and how video games are confirmed for fairness.

4. Provably Fair Gaming
Trust is a major factor in online betting. How can a player be sure the casino isn't rigging the video games? Bitcoin casinos revolutionized this by introducing Provably Fair innovation. Utilizing cryptographic algorithms, gamers can separately validate the fairness of each and every single video game round, guaranteeing your home hasn't damaged the result.

Potential Risks to Keep in Mind
While Bitcoin casinos provide many benefits, gamers need to likewise know prospective downsides:
- Cryptocurrency Volatility: The worth of Bitcoin fluctuates continuously. If the rate of BTC drops considerably while your funds are on the platform, your bankroll's acquiring power reductions.
- Regulative Gray Areas: The legal status of crypto gambling differs heavily by jurisdiction. Players ought to always examine regional laws before placing bets.
- Permanent Transactions: Blockchain transactions can not be reversed. If you send out Bitcoin to the incorrect address, the funds are permanently lost.
- Absence of Recourse: Because crypto gambling establishments are decentralized, fixing disputes can sometimes be more tough if a platform acts unethically. Stick to casinos with tested performance history and valid licenses (e.g., Curacao eGaming).
